An Australian mother of a teenage girl has accused a Jetstar flight attendant of using passenger list information to stalk her daughter.
Just two hours after the flight touched down in Melbourne the man allegedly added her on Facebook without ever asking her for her name. He then sent messages to her asking why she has not added him as a friend.
Jetstar Australia says passenger details are protected and the male attendant was not entitled to access it.
The mother, who was on the flight with her daughter, has complained about the breach of privacy.
